Posted by: Yakub Oloyede« on: July 09, 2015, 12:09:18 PM »Former Super Eagles midfielder Sani Kaita has been declared missing by his Nigeria Professional Football League side, FC Ifeanyi Ubah of Nnewi. The club manager John Obu, according to News Agency of Nigeria revealed that the midfielder has not bee seen or heard from since July 1 after a match. After a short spell with Enyimba of Aba, Kaita joined Nnewi based league club, Ifeanyi Uba in May on a 3-year-deal. The former Kano Pillars midfielder did not report to Sunday’s 1-0 victory over Shooting Stars and has now being declared missing. “What happened is, when we travelled to Port Harcourt, we were to leave immediately after the game and he was not part of those of us who left and up till now, we have not seen him,” Obi is quoted to say by NAN. “I don’t need to look for him, he needs to tell me where he is. If he fails to tell me where he is, then we will report to LMC (League Management Company) of his absconding.
